2026 Best Value General Organizational Communication Schools in the Southwest Region
If you want to know which schools deliver the best value for the general organizational communication degrees they offer, see the list below.
Best Value General Organizational Communication Schools
Leading the list is The University Of Texas At El Paso, our #1 best value for general organizational communication in the Southwest Region. The University Of Texas At El Paso is a very large public school located in the city of El Paso. The average in-state cost of tuition and fees is $9,544, while out-of-state students pay about $25,502. Typical student debt for general organizational communication graduates is $22,000. General Organizational Communication graduates of The University Of Texas At El Paso earn a median of $33,280 early in their careers. Weighed against typical debt, the earnings make a compelling case for value. The acceptance rate is 100%.
Students looking for strong value in general organizational communication will find it at The University Of Texas At Austin, which ranked #2. Located in the city of Austin, The University Of Texas At Austin is a very large public university.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$11,688, while out-of-state students pay about $44,908. Typical student debt for general organizational communication graduates is $20,995. Soon after graduation, general organizational communication degree recipients from The University Of Texas At Austin generally make around $51,267. That is a strong return on a $20,995 median debt. Roughly 27% of applicants are accepted.
University Of Central Oklahoma came in at #3 on our 2026 list of the best value general organizational communication schools. Set in the suburb of Edmond, University Of Central Oklahoma is a large public institution. In-state tuition and fees average $8,818, with out-of-state students paying around $19,704. Students borrow a median of $21,500 to complete the general organizational communication program here. Soon after graduation, general organizational communication degree recipients from University Of Central Oklahoma generally make around $36,388. That is a strong return on a $21,500 median debt. The acceptance rate is 78%.
East Texas Baptist University is a great value for students pursuing a degree in general organizational communication, landing the #4 spot this year. Set in the town of Marshall, East Texas Baptist University is a small private not-for-profit institution. The average in-state cost of tuition and fees is $30,680. Students borrow a median of $25,137 to complete the general organizational communication program here. General Organizational Communication graduates of East Texas Baptist University earn a median of $44,734 early in their careers. Weighed against typical debt, the earnings make a compelling case for value. Roughly 58% of applicants are accepted.
Southern Methodist University came in at #5 on our 2026 list of the best value general organizational communication schools. Set in the suburb of Dallas, Southern Methodist University is a large private not-for-profit institution. Students from in state pay about $67,040 in tuition and fees. General Organizational Communication graduates carry a median of $19,750 in student loans. General Organizational Communication graduates of Southern Methodist University earn a median of $51,828 early in their careers. Weighed against typical debt, the earnings make a compelling case for value. The acceptance rate is 63%.
